Comic-Con 2019: Where to nerd out after hours

The ultimate guide to partying in San Diego during Comic-Con 2019.
Comic-Con is fast approaching, and the buzz for the 50th annual affair is already here. Though attendees have likely already mapped out their daily schedule of panels and exhibitions, where is one to go after the Convention Center doors close? From nerd karaoke to booze cruises to a Star Wars Cantina replica, here’s the ultimate party guide where fans can continue the fun when the lights go down.
